【技术实现步骤摘要】
信号的处理方法及装置
本专利技术涉及通信领域,具体而言,涉及一种信号的处理方法及装置。
技术介绍
在超高频系统中,邻信道功率泄漏是衡量读写器射频性能的一项重要指标,该指标表明工作信号本信道的发射功率与其落到邻信道功率的比值。而工作信号的频谱特性是受基带信号的频谱特性所影响,也就是说,可以通过调整基带信号的频谱特性达到控制工作信号频谱特性的目的。目前,通常所使用的方法是在FPGA(FieldProgrammableGateArray,现场可编程门阵列)中实现一个数字的低通滤波器,来限制基带信号的带宽,进而限制工作信号的频谱带宽。但是由于FPGA内部资源的限制,该数字滤波器的阶数通常无法做到很高,这样就导致滤波器的阻带衰减比较缓慢,还是会有部分频率的信号滤除不彻底,导致邻信道功率泄漏指标恶化,并且FPGA进行滤波处理还会导致信号的延时。
技术实现思路
本专利技术实施例提供了一种信号的处理方法及装置,以至少解决相关技术中在FPGA中实现的数字低通滤波器来限制基带信号带宽的方式,存在同等资源下信号滤除不彻底,导致邻信道功率泄漏指标恶化的问题。根据本专利技术的一个实施例,提供了一种信号的处理方法,包括:通过现场可编程逻辑门阵列FPGA模块获取到与目标数据对应的基带码元的第一波形数据和前导码的第二波形数据,其中,所述第一波形数据是对所述基带码元进行低通滤波和拟合后得到的波形数据,所述第二波形数据是对所述前导码进行低通滤波和拟合后得到的波形数据;将所述FPGA模块的输出信号进行数模转换,得到模拟 ...
【技术保护点】
1.一种信号的处理方法,其特征在于,包括:/n通过现场可编程逻辑门阵列FPGA模块获取到与目标数据对应的基带码元的第一波形数据和前导码的第二波形数据,其中,所述第一波形数据是对所述基带码元进行低通滤波和拟合后得到的波形数据,所述第二波形数据是对所述前导码进行低通滤波和拟合后得到的波形数据;/n将所述FPGA模块的输出信号进行数模转换,得到模拟信号,其中,所述输出信号为按照所述目标数据所指示的顺序将所述第一波形数据和所述第二波形数据进行输出得到的信号;/n通过第一低通滤波器对所述模拟信号进行滤波,得到与所述目标数据对应的基带信号。/n
【技术特征摘要】
1.一种信号的处理方法,其特征在于,包括:
通过现场可编程逻辑门阵列FPGA模块获取到与目标数据对应的基带码元的第一波形数据和前导码的第二波形数据,其中,所述第一波形数据是对所述基带码元进行低通滤波和拟合后得到的波形数据,所述第二波形数据是对所述前导码进行低通滤波和拟合后得到的波形数据;
将所述FPGA模块的输出信号进行数模转换,得到模拟信号,其中,所述输出信号为按照所述目标数据所指示的顺序将所述第一波形数据和所述第二波形数据进行输出得到的信号;
通过第一低通滤波器对所述模拟信号进行滤波,得到与所述目标数据对应的基带信号。
2.根据权利要求1所述的方法,其特征在于,通过所述FPGA模块获取到与所述目标数据对应的所述基带码元的所述第一波形数据和所述前导码的所述第二波形数据包括:
通过FPGA模块获取到所述前导码的所述第二波形数据;
通过所述FPGA模块获取到所述目标数据所指示的所述基带码元的所述第一波形数据;
通过FPGA模块依次将获取到的所述第二波形数据和所述第一波形数据输出。
3.根据权利要求1所述的方法,其特征在于,通过所述FPGA模块获取到与所述目标数据对应的所述基带码元的所述第一波形数据和所述前导码的所述第二波形数据包括:
通过所述FPGA模块从波形数据文件中,读取到所述第一波形数据和所述第二波形数据,其中,所述波形数据文件中预先存储有所述第一波形数据和所述第二波形数据。
4.根据权利要求1所述的方法,其特征在于,在通过所述FPGA模块获取到与所述目标数据对应的所述基带码元的所述第一波形数据和所述前导码的所述第二波形数据之前,所述方法还包括:
使用第二低通滤波器对第一预定个数的所述基带码元进行滤波处理,得到第一预定个数的第一中间波形数据;
使用第三低通滤波器对所述前导码进行滤波处理,得到第二中间波形数据;
采用多项式插值的方式对第一预定个数的所述第一中间波形数据和所述第二中间波形数据进行拟合,得到第一预定个数的所述第一波形数据和所述第二波形数据。
5.根据权利要求4所述的方法,其特征在于,使用所述第二低通滤波器对第一预定个数的所述基带码元进行处理,得到第一预定个数的所述第一中间波形数据包括:
将第一预定个数的所述基带码元按照排列组合的方式进行两两编码,得到的第二预定个数的编码数据;
使用所述第二低通滤波器对第二预定个数的所述编码数据进行滤波,并进行归一化处理,得到第二预定个数的归一化数据;
分别从第二预定个数的所述归一化数据中提取出与各基带码元对应、且满足阈值条件的第一目标个数的第一待选波形数据,其中,所述阈值条件为波形数据的起始点幅值和终点幅值与所述波形数据的幅值中点的差值在目标阈值范围以内;
分别从第一目标个数的所述第一待选波形数据,选取出重复次数最多、且起始点幅值大于或等于终点幅值的波形数据,作为与各基带码元对应的所述第一中间波形数据。
6.根据权利要求4所述的方法,其特征在于,采用多项式插值的方式对第一预定个数的所述第一中间波形数据和所述第二中间波形数据进行拟合,得到第一预定个数的所述第一波形数据和所述第二波形数据包括:
将第一预定个数的所述第一中间波形数据进行两个拼接,得到第二预定个数的第一拼接数据;
将所述第二中间波形数据拼接在各第一拼接数据之前,得到第二预定个数的第二拼接数据;
采用所述多项式插值的方式分别对第二预定个数的所述第二拼接数据进行拟合,得到第二预定个数的拟合数据;
从第二预定个数的所述拟合数据中提取出与各基带码元对应的第二目标个数的第二待选波形数据;
从第二目标个数的所述第二待选波形数据中,选取出重复次数最多、且起始点幅值大于或等于终点幅值的波形数据,作为与各基带码元对应的所述第一波形数据;
从第二预定个数的所述拟合数据中提取出与所述前导码对应的第二预定个数的第三待选波形数据;
从第二预定个数的所述第三待选波形数据中,选取重复次数最多、且起始点幅值大于或等于终点幅值的波形数据,作为所述第二波形数据。
7.根据权利要求1至6中任一项所述的方法,其特征在于,在通过所述第一低通滤波器对所述模拟信号进行滤波,得到与所述目标数据对应的所述基带信号之后,所述方法还包括:
使用具有目标频率的载波对所述基带信号进行调制,得到调制信号;
通过目标信道进行发送得到的所述调制信号。
8.一种信号的处理装置,其特征在于,所述装置包括:现场可编程逻辑门阵列FPGA模块、数字模拟D/A转换器和第一低通滤波器,其中,
所述FPGA模块,与所述D/A转换器相连,用于获...
【专利技术属性】
技术研发人员:王鹏鹏,胡溢文,吴雷,周行,胡攀攀,
申请(专利权)人:武汉万集信息技术有限公司,
类型:发明
国别省市:湖北;42
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。